Turkey's president Recep Tayyip Erdogan and his conservative AK party have suffered a major blow in local elections. Turkey's main opposition party, the secular CHP, claimed victory in key cities, including Istanbul and the capital Ankara. Erdogan called the setback a "loss of altitude" and said his party would "analyse" the message the people had given him. The votes are seen as a bellwether of support for Erdogan after his twenty years in power.
